Sebastian's POV

The service was coming to an end, finally. Sebastian was getting bored out of his mind. Not to mention the church made him feel uneasy, for obvious reasons.

People began leaving and the demon got ready to offer Y/N her coat before heading outside, but stopped halfway through his action once seeing her expression. Her gaze was lost somewhere up front, where the body of a young man lay still in an open coffin.

Without saying a word, Y/N got up and made her way towards him. People were expressing their condolences as she passed them, but the Phantomhive payed them no attention.

Sebastian trailed behind her.

She stopped before the coffin, caressing the person inside with her gaze. The butler stood at her side, contemplating how much space he should give her. Human emotions were still strangers to him, so he guessed the best he could.

They stood like that for a little while, in silence.

All the guests had long left the church when the priest came up to them. He said it was time for the coffin to be taken away and that they should say their final goodbyes. Y/N answered him with a simple nod, but remained as she was.

Another little while passed. They watched as the polished lid hid Alexander's face from view for the last time, and staff members carried the coffin away.

And then it was just the two of them.

The overwhelming silence of the room rang in Sebastian's ears.

He suddenly noticed that Y/N's hands were trembling. And not only her hands, her whole body was shaking.

Should he do something about it? Or should he just wait for orders?

He was about to speak when Y/N suddenly turned to face him. She seemed spaced out, looking somewhere beyond him.

Slowly, she bowed down her head and leaned in to rest her weight against Sebastian's chest, hiding her face in his vest.

He was slightly taken aback, as she would never approach him first. He'd always be the one teasing her by invading her personal space, but most of the time Y/N would try to keep her distance with him. This was very unexpected of her.

A small sob escaped the girl. Was she crying? Is that why she was trying to hide her face away?

Now that there was no one to watch, her walls must have finally broken down.

So helpless.

Sebastian smiled.

Did she trust him enough to show her vulnerable self to him?

No. This wasn't trust, he realized. He was her servant and she had the right to use him however she pleased. Whether it was as a soldier or as a shoulder to cry on.

But he was happy to even mean that much to her, if it meant being close.

Sebastian brought both his arms around Y/N and gently pulled her into a tight hug, and this time, she didn't push him away or get mad at him. She only buried her face deeper into his clothes.

The girl was so small and warm, and her body trembled against his. Sebastian felt her wrap her arms around his back, returning the hug. She clutched his clothes in her shaking fists, bringing him in closer. He couldn't tell which one of them needed this more. If only he could stay like this with her forever - so close that he could feel her heartbeat on his skin.

Sebastian bit his tongue to keep his thoughts from wondering to places they shouldn't.

Y/N was sobbing uncontrollably. Her warm tears soaked through the fabric of his clothes.

"Shhh," he patted her hair, "deep breaths, deep breaths."

She did just that, taking one shattered breath after another. Sebastian kept stroking her head with his hand. He brought some of the fallen locks of hair behind her ears.

"Let's go home," she murmured against him after having calmed down a little.

She pulled away from their embrace. Makeup leaked down her flushed cheeks, her eyes were red and puffy and her long, wet eyelashes clung together.

She looked anywhere but at him, as he helped her into her coat.

Embarrassed?

Sebastian smiled and followed her to the carriage already waiting for them at the entrance.

Their ride to the manor was completely silent. Y/N didn't utter a single word and always kept her eyes on the floor.

Sebastian took the opportunity to study her features. The delicate curves and angles of her face, she shape of her lips, her nose. Y/N was truly beautiful, even when crying.

Her hands were interlaced on her lap and she played with the delicate white diamond ring - the engagement ring. She stroke it gently, always staring off into the distance.

There was no point in mourning the dead. They were gone from this world, that's it that's all. The sooner she'd realize it, the faster would the pain go away.

Sebastian sighed.

People were such delicate creatures. He'd witnessed countless souls get eaten away by emotions after living through the loss of a close someone.

But the Phantomhive girl was different.

Surely she was broken now, but she'd find a way to rebuild herself and find her step. She did it once before, she could do it again. Her soul was a strong and a pure one, otherwise why would he crave it so badly?

Y/N's POV

During the ride to the Phantomhive estate, thoughts of Alexander drowned out any others, yet the whole time, out of the corner of my mind, I could feel the demon's burning eyes on me.
